Adequate versus inadequate weight gain and socioeconomic factors of pregnant women followed up in primary care

Abstract Objectives: to identify the socioeconomic factors associated with inadequate (excessive and insufficient) weight gain in women followed during prenatal care in Basic Health Units in a Municipality of the Countryside of Ceará.
